The Ultimate Guide to Scandinavian Decor

Introduction

Scandinavian decor has gained immense popularity in recent years for its minimalist and functional design. This style originated from the Nordic region, encompassing countries like Denmark, Sweden, Norway, and Finland. Its emphasis on simplicity, natural materials, and clean lines has made it a favorite choice for homeowners looking to create a serene and welcoming space. In this ultimate guide, we will explore the key elements and principles of Scandinavian decor and provide tips on how to incorporate this style into your home.

What is Scandinavian Decor?

Scandinavian decor is characterized by its minimalistic and functional design. It focuses on creating a clutter-free and cozy environment by using neutral colors, natural materials, and plenty of natural light. This style aims to bring nature indoors and create a sense of calmness and relaxation.

Key Elements of Scandinavian Decor

1. Neutral Colors

Neutral colors such as white, gray, and beige are commonly used in Scandinavian decor. These colors help to create a bright and airy atmosphere, making the space feel larger and more open.

2. Natural Materials

Scandinavian decor emphasizes the use of natural materials like wood, leather, and wool. These materials add warmth and texture to the space while maintaining the simplicity of the design.

3. Clean Lines

Clean and simple lines are another characteristic of Scandinavian decor. Furniture and accessories with sleek and uncomplicated designs are preferred to create a minimalist look.

Tips for Incorporating Scandinavian Decor

1. Declutter and Simplify

Start by decluttering your space and keeping only the essentials. Scandinavian decor is all about simplicity, so make sure to remove any unnecessary items.

2. Use Light Colored Furniture

Invest in light-colored furniture pieces to create a sense of spaciousness. Opt for clean and simple designs that align with the Scandinavian aesthetic.

3. Add Natural Elements

Bring nature indoors by incorporating plants and natural materials. Use wooden furniture, rattan baskets, and fresh greenery to add a touch of nature to your space.

Benefits of Scandinavian Decor

There are several benefits to incorporating Scandinavian decor into your home:

1. Creates a Calm and Serene Atmosphere

The minimalistic and clutter-free design of Scandinavian decor helps create a calm and serene atmosphere, promoting relaxation and well-being.

2. Maximizes Natural Light

Scandinavian decor utilizes light colors and minimal window treatments to maximize natural light. This not only makes the space feel brighter but also helps improve mood and productivity.

3. Enhances Functionality

The functional design of Scandinavian decor ensures that every item serves a purpose. This helps in maximizing space and creating an organized and efficient home.
